Output fd81eb669561d633461e2c4c437ff0a75a8d053a733834577a7ac7d52e105c54:152

value
3527
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db4c0eeb45be2a490bef550f5968088b3e143ece6d125027287d20a750aa77d1
address
bc1pmdxqa669hc4yjzl02584j6qg3vlpg0kwd5f9qfeg05s2w592wlgsanru6w
transaction
fd81eb669561d633461e2c4c437ff0a75a8d053a733834577a7ac7d52e105c54
confirmations
92646
spent
true